我通常将Drupal数据库从phpMyAdmin的一个实例导出到另一个服务器上,没有任何问题,但是最近我在导入时遇到了错误:
#3510 - Tablespace my_database doesn't exist.导致问题的SQL行是:
/*!50100 TABLESPACE `my_database` */ ENGINE=InnoDB DEFAULT CHARSET=utf8我以前从未遇到过表空间,在phpMyAdmin中,我无法在导出或导入过程中避免这个问题。
在导出/导入时,如何避免不存在表空间的问题?
服务器版本: 5.7.23 - MySQL社区服务器
议定书版本: 10
服务器版本: 8.0.22-0ubuntu0.20.04.3
议定书版本: 10
发布于 2020-12-29 18:01:52
在导入之前,将文本/*!50100 TABLESPACE `my_database` */移除到导出的MySQL文件中的任何位置都可以解决这个问题。
https://webmasters.stackexchange.com/questions/132646
复制相似问题